"Dressed for Success" - SCTE's first Balkans conference meets with success SCTE is delighted to report an extremely successful fi rst Balkan Broadband conference and exhibition in Kosovo on 12 March 2009. The event attracted 192 registered visitors from 17 countries with 22 international brands represented (from 14 countries) on the exhibition floor. |

The SCTE-Benelux Group Elects New Committee Rien Baan, Secretary to the SCTE-Benelux Group reports that, at its meeting in October this year, a new committee was elected. The Benelux group is a self administered sub-committee of the SCTE Executive and is responsible for coordinating Society activities in the Benelux countries including the organisation of lectures such as those at IBC every year. |
